Ciaron O'Reilly interview on Galway FM on further plans to Demilitarise Shannon

category galway | anti-war / imperialism | other press author Saturday September 23, 2006 12:03author by Galway Solidarityauthor address Galway Report this post to the editors

Below is the link to Keith Finnegan Show interview with Ciaron O'Reilly one of the acquitted Pit Stop Plloughshares www.peaceontrial.com
The interviewer questions O'Reilly on the disarmamaent action at Shannon in Feb. '03, questions O'Reilly's take on Catholicism, his source of income, plans for further nonviolent direct action to demilitarise Shannon. It's a lively debate, O'Reilly gives as good as he gets. Worrth a listen!
